Overview

SPC5643LFF2MMM1 from NXP Semiconductors is a dual-core automotive microcontroller based on Power Architecture e200z4d CPUs operating up to 120 MHz, featuring 1 MB flash with ECC, 128 KB SRAM with ECC, and integrated FlexRay, dual FlexCAN 2.0B, and SIL3/ASIL-D safety architecture for lockstep operation. It targets electric power steering (EPS), airbag control, and EHPS systems.

Technical Context

The SPC5643LFF2MMM1 implements two replicated e200z4d cores supporting both LockStep mode (for ASIL-D fault detection) and Decoupled Parallel mode (for high-performance dual-task execution), each with 4 KB instruction cache, MMU, VLE, and SPE. Its crossbar switch provides four master ports (dual BIUs, eDMA, FlexRay) and three slave ports (flash controller, SRAM controller, peripheral bridge).

Safety is enforced via Sphere of Replication (SoR) covering CPU, eDMA, and XBAR; Fault Collection and Control Unit (FCCU); Redundancy Control and Checker Unit (RCCU); boot-time MBIST/LBIST; replicated watchdog and junction temperature sensors; and 16-region MPU. All safety-critical peripherals-including FlexCAN, FlexRay, ADC, and CTU-are integrated within the SoR boundary.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Core Architecture e200z4d dual core, Power Architecture v2.03, Harvard bus, 5-stage pipeline, VLE & SPE support
Max Core Frequency 120 MHz with ±2% frequency modulation; enables real-time motor control loop execution at ≤1 µs latency
Memory 1 MB flash with ECC and RWW capability + 128 KB SRAM with ECC; supports EEPROM emulation in flash
Safety Certification SIL3 / ASIL-D compliant via LockStep mode, FCCU, RCCU, replicated peripherals, and boot-time BIST
Communication Interfaces 2× FlexCAN 2.0B (32 message objects each), 2× LINFlexD, 3× DSPI, 1× FlexRay v2.1 (2 channels, 64 buffers, 10 Mbit/s)
Analog & Timing 2× 12-bit ADC (16 ch total), programmable CTU for ADC/PWM/timer synchronization, 3× eTimer (6 ch each), 2× FlexPWM (4 ch each)
Package & Environment 257-pin MAPBGA (14 mm × 14 mm × 0.8 mm), -40 °C to 125 °C ambient, -40 °C to 150 °C junction

Pinout & Package

SPC5643LFF2MMM1 uses a 257-ball MAPBGA package (14 mm × 14 mm × 0.8 mm) with 1.0 mm ball pitch, designed for automotive PCB layouts requiring thermal and EMI robustness. Pin assignments follow NXP's MPC5643L pinout specification (Rev. 10, Section 2.1), with dedicated supply, ground, clock, reset, Nexus debug, and functional I/O balls distributed across the array.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
VDD_MAIN Main core supply 3.0–3.6 V input powering CPU, memory, and digital logic; requires local 100 nF + 10 µF decoupling
VDD_ANA Analog supply Independent 3.0–3.6 V rail for ADC, CTU, SWG; isolated from digital noise to maintain 12-bit accuracy
XTAL_IN / XTAL_OUT Crystal oscillator interface Supports 4–40 MHz external crystal; internal FMPLL generates system clocks with spread-spectrum modulation
NEXUS_TDI / TDO / TCK / TMS Nexus Class 3+ debug port Enables real-time trace, non-intrusive debugging, and safety-critical software validation per ISO 26262
FLEXRAY_A_TX / RX FlexRay Channel A differential pair Compliant with FlexRay v2.1 physical layer; supports 2.5–10 Mbit/s data rates with built-in protocol engine
CAN0_TX / CAN0_RX FlexCAN 0 differential interface ISO 11898-1 compliant; supports CAN FD framing when used with external transceiver; 32 configurable message objects

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Dual e200z4d LockStep Core Hardware-enforced instruction-level comparison between cores detects transient faults; triggers FCCU-safe state transition
Replicated Safety Peripherals FCCU, RCCU, CTU, ADC, eTimer, and FlexCAN modules duplicated and cross-checked-no single point of failure in SoR
On-chip Flash with RWW 1 MB flash partitioned for simultaneous code execution and firmware update without system halt; ECC corrects 1-bit errors
FlexRay v2.1 Module Two independent channels, 64 message buffers, deterministic time-triggered communication for x-by-wire applications
Programmable Cross Triggering Unit (CTU) Synchronizes ADC sampling, PWM edge generation, and eTimer events with sub-microsecond precision-critical for motor FOC

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ar automotive safety microcontroller appl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
MPC5643LFF2MLL1 Same die, 144-pin LQFP package (20 mm × 20 mm × 1.4 mm); lacks eTimer_2 and second FlexPWM module Limited I/O count and no external eTimer_2 access; suitable for cost-sensitive EPS variants without complex timing requirements Select only if board space allows larger LQFP and application does not require BGA-specific peripherals
SPC56EL70L5COY Single e200z7 core (180 MHz), 2 MB flash, no FlexRay, enhanced CAN FD support, same 257 MAPBGA footprint Higher performance for ADAS domain controllers but lacks FlexRay and dual-core lockstep for ASIL-D actuation Choose when migrating from SPC5643LFF2MMM1 to CAN FD-centric architectures without FlexRay dependency

Compared with SPC5643LFF2MMM1, MPC5643LFF2MLL1 trades FlexRay and BGA-optimized peripherals for lower-cost packaging, while SPC56EL70L5COY upgrades core speed and flash capacity but abandons FlexRay and lockstep safety-making it unsuitable for ASIL-D actuation where SPC5643LFF2MMM1 remains the validated choice.

FAQ

What is the package type and dimensions of the SPC5643LFF2MMM1?

The SPC5643LFF2MMM1 uses a 257-ball MAPBGA package measuring 14 mm × 14 mm × 0.8 mm with 1.0 mm ball pitch. This compact, thermally efficient package is qualified for automotive under-hood environments and supports high-density routing for safety-critical signal integrity. The SPC5643LFF2MMM1 pinout is fully documented in NXP's MPC5643L datasheet Rev. 10, Section 2.1.

Does the SPC5643LFF2MMM1 support ASIL-D compliance out of the box?

Yes-the SPC5643LFF2MMM1 achieves ASIL-D compliance through hardware-enforced features including dual-core LockStep execution, Sphere of Replication (SoR) for CPU/eDMA/XBAR, FCCU fault reporting, boot-time MBIST/LBIST, and replicated watchdog/timer/ADC modules. Full qualification evidence is provided in NXP's Safety Application Guide for MPC5643L, which applies directly to the SPC5643LFF2MMM1.

What debug interface does the SPC5643LFF2MMM1 provide?

The SPC5643LFF2MMM1 integrates a Nexus Class 3+ debug port with TDI/TDO/TCK/TMS pins, enabling real-time instruction trace, non-intrusive breakpoints, and safety-critical software validation per ISO 26262. This interface supports third-party tools like Lauterbach TRACE32 and iSystem winIDEA for ASIL-D development workflows. The SPC5643LFF2MMM1 debug capabilities are identical across all MPC5643L variants.

Can the SPC5643LFF2MMM1 execute code while writing to flash memory?

Yes-the SPC5643LFF2MMM1 supports Read-While-Write (RWW) functionality in its 1 MB flash memory, allowing concurrent code execution and firmware updates without halting the CPU. This capability is enabled by hardware partitioning and ECC protection, and is validated in the SPC5643LFF2MMM1's flash controller architecture per Section 1.5.5 of the datasheet.

Which communication protocols are supported by the SPC5643LFF2MMM1 for automotive networking?

The SPC5643LFF2MMM1 natively supports FlexRay v2.1 (2 channels, 10 Mbit/s), dual FlexCAN 2.0B interfaces (32 message objects each), 2× LINFlexD UART/LIN modules, and 3× DSPI controllers. These protocols meet AUTOSAR-compliant automotive networking requirements for x-by-wire, powertrain, and body control domains. All interfaces are included in the SPC5643LFF2MMM1 silicon configuration without external transceivers.
